This story ebbed and flowed across the wires all night, last night, as Pawn drifted in and out of sleep to the dulcet tones of the BBC news readers. The New York Times however, came up with the most disarming of headlines, “Musharraf Decides Against Emergency”:

ISLAMABAD, Pakistan (AP) — President Gen. Pervez Musharraf on Thursday decided against declaring a state of emergency in Pakistan and will press ahead with plans to hold free and fair elections, a government minister said.
Pakistani media have been reporting that the military leader would impose a state of emergency to deal with rising violence and political instability — a move that a senior government official confirmed was under consideration.
